Certain terms of a contract can still be binding even after termination. Or new terms can be agreed as part of any settlement.

NDAs are the obvious example. But restraint of trade can also be binding for a certain period of time so QPR can prevent MC taking another job (particularly with a direct rival) unless there is payment of compensation.
